BIRKIRKARA, MALTA, April 20, 2011 (Press-News.org) The third annual Banking Finance & Insurance Expo - "Exploiting Technology to Deliver Customised Financial Services" - took place in Kampala, Uganda at the Main Exhibition Hall Lugogo from 14-16th April.

According to the organisers, the main objective of Banking Finance & Insurance Expo is to unlock the great potential that lies in Uganda's financial sector by giving the public access to financial information.

deVere Group Area Manager for Kampala, Julie Crombie, therefore identified the Expo as the ideal opportunity to raise awareness of the deVere brand which has recently been introduced to the Kampala financial services market and thus, The deVere Group, the world's largest international financial consultancy group, attended the event as exhibitors for the first time.

Julie and her team of Consultants and Coordinators worked tirelessly over the three day Expo to introduce the deVere Group to the thousands of visitors who attended the Expo.

"I believe the Expo was a wonderful opportunity to introduce the deVere brand to investors in Uganda," commented Julie adding that "the opportunities identified by exhibiting at the show will result in increased levels of new business through the Kampala office."

In addition, the organisers of the Expo ran an exit poll of visitors covering their experience, the results of which were announced at the closing cocktail event. The deVere booth and staff were awarded the Organisers Top Award, a prestigious commendation for the HIGHEST STANDARDS OF BOOTH ETIQUETTE reflecting on the exceptional levels of professionalism displayed by the team throughout the show.

Accepting the award, Julie commented: "this is a testimony to deVere Group standards, I believe that we have heightened our clients expectations in this market, and displayed the way forward to many of our fellow exhibitors."
